Output 19338054695432ecaa24b463db4546172634d8eecb80adadd31525c118458dce:0

value
34783
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 511c3e54d3bf93805076d229cd9b6954dca5257f52ce5d86aa81a56426eed1d5
address
bc1p2ywru4xnh7fcq5rk6g5umxmf2nw22ftl2t89mp42sxjkgfhw682sdzd4y4
transaction
19338054695432ecaa24b463db4546172634d8eecb80adadd31525c118458dce
spent
true